Face to Face With the Truth

Released

The debut 1971 album from Norman Whitfield’s musical vehicle The Undisputed Truth is psychedelia meets soul and funk via layers of funky guitars, big, memorable basslines, plenty of studio experimentation from Whitfield and a mood that is, throughout the first half of the album, dark and oppressive. The last three tracks in contrast sweeten the mood with more traditional Motown soul fair including a vamp-filled take on Marvin Gaye’s ‘What’s Going On.’
